Product Details
- 10 pack of MyoWare Reference 2.0 Cables meant as extension for MyoWare 2.0 Muscle Sensor's reference pin
- Insert the pin into its housing and place a biomedical sensor pad into the electrode snap
- Stick the reference cable's snap pin to a separate section of the body inaccessible by the built-in reference pin
- Reference electrode socket remains active even with the cable inserted
- Disable the socket by cutting the jumper trace or re-enable by shorting the jumper pads with solder
- Not inclusive of MyoWare 2.0 Muscle Sensor, Power Shield, and EMG pads - need to be purchased separately
